- What is Babcock & Wilcox Enterprises's operating income?
- Babcock & Wilcox Enterprises (BW) reported operating income of -$1.66M in Q1 2026.
- How has Babcock & Wilcox Enterprises's operating income changed year-over-year?
- Babcock & Wilcox Enterprises's operating income increased by 10.1% year-over-year, from -$1.84M to -$1.66M.
- What is the long-term trend for Babcock & Wilcox Enterprises's operating income?
- Over 3 years (2021 to 2025), Babcock & Wilcox Enterprises's operating income has grown at a -1.3%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from $19.42M to $18.66M.
- What does operating income mean?
- Gross profit minus all operating expenses (SG&A, R&D, D&A). Measures the profit from core business operations before interest, taxes, and non-operating items.
